LAUNCHXL-F28377S: Selection of BoosterPack and LaunchPad for 5 Stepper Motor

Part Number: LAUNCHXL-F28377S

I need to control 5 stepper motor. My application is a robot arm.

Stepper Motor Characteristics:
-2-phase hybrid stepper motor
-Nominal Voltage: 24V
-Nominal Current: 4.2 A

I also need to measure the signal coming from 5 incremental enconder with an operating voltage of 5 VDC.

I need advice about wich are the appropriate BoosterPack and LaunchPad.

I have seen BOOSTXL-ULN2003 and BOOSTXL-DRV8301. An this Launchpad TMS320F28377S, but maybe there are other options that you can suggest me.

I would also like to calculate the angles that the motor has to move with MatLab, and generate the C code from there in order to give this data to the microcontroller or Launchpad.

Please, guide me a litle bit in the selection of this components.

  • If you are performing research and not necessary for product design, I think you will be fine to test with TMS320F28377S LaunchPad and BOOSTXL-ULN2003. You will need multiple of these to run 5 stepper motors. The output power will be limited by the BoosterPack current rating, but if you are happy with the setup, you can investigate more powerful devices for future development.
